Packing powder is made of matte plastic with a glossy white cover. The powder flows through the mesh. By the way, to get a lot of product, for example, baking, I close the lid the packing and just tilt it on the mantle there is a large amount of powder, which is very convenient to type with a sponge.

And does not scatter powder all over the box due to the stopper on the lid. He keeps all the powder in the area of the mesh — a very convenient system.

The color of powder one Invisible.

Despite the fact that in the package, and swatches it appears yellowish on the face it goes bright veil — I can’t call it transparent, as it gives a slight brightening.

Composition:

Coconut Alkanes: Help extend wear.
Coconut Milk: Thoroughly hydrates.
Coconut Water: Provides refreshing electrolytes.
Coconut Polysaccharides: Help condition skin.
Talc,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Seed Butter, Synthetic Fluorphlogopite, Zinc Stearate, Caprylyl Glycol, Phenoxyethanol, Hexylene Glycol, Fragrance, Silica, Linalool, Peg-7 Glyceryl Cocoate, C9-12 Alkane, Butylene Glycol, Cocos Nucifera (Coconut) Water, Coco-Caprylate/Caprate, Withania Somnifera Root Extract, Iron Oxides (Ci 77491, Ci 77492, Ci 77499).

On our website, Sephora claimed that the powder needs to fix makeup and Matt skin. My skin is oily, it floats forever, so promise me very intrigued.

Clearly this powder manifests itself in conjunction with the Double Wear Foundation Nude from EL — it hides the extra Shine, but it does not make a person deaf Matt rather get a natural finish. Also with this tone powder perfectly smoothes pores — but with other, more stable tones, this magic is somehow not the case…

For illustrative purposes photo with flash:

Don’t look at the color of the neck flash being weird…

The manufacturer claims 8 hours of resistance, but, unfortunately, for my oily skin all the promises it is necessary to divide by two — but not in this case! Really good powder keeps makeup — I begin to Shine only in the end of the day. In addition, the makeup really lasts on me the whole time. My most sore spots — the wings of the nose and cheeks, but even they tone, fixed powder, does not leave me until the evening washing.

The main drawback of this powder — in spite of such a solid and great package we put only 8 grams of product!

A little comparative characteristics.

On the Sephora website, this powder is $ 44. Compare with most popular powders.

Huda Beauty $ 34 — 20 gram.

Laura Mercier is $ 38 — 29 grams.

Too Faced (Born This Way) — $ 33 per 17 grams.

Total price — amount of product, powder Grade is about on par with powder Hourglass — $ 46 in 10.5 grams of product.

Summary: this is a pretty decent working powder. She keeps makeup and mattes, but not tightly, leaving a nice natural finish without excess Shine. Packaging with a stopper changed my vision of a very uncomfortable use flying loose powder. It’s good, but I believe that the ratio of high price and such a small amount of the product is not justified by anything — even the luxury brand.

Price: 2800 R. in our Sephora.

Rating: 5 for powder, unless you consider the price.
